With all this bashing of the CC I thought I ought to add some balance by posting something positive.

 

In June I stayed at the CC site at Bolton Abbey for a few days. Whilst there my wedding ring went missing. It could have been lost on a walk through the countryside, or even in Skipton town centre. Anyway I mentioned it to the wardens, just in case someone found it on site.

 

About a month later I got a  phone call from a warden to say they'd found a wedding ring whilst raking up leaves on the pitch I'd used. From the description it sounded like my ring and as we were due to revisit the site at the end of August the warden agreed to keep the ring in their site safe 'til I could collect it.

 

With much good humoured banter I collected the ring as arranged and a 42 year emblem of our marriage is now back through my nose.

 

Funnily enough it wasn't the first time that ring had gone missing. Back around 2000 I lost it and months later came across it, by accident, amongst the gravel on our drive.

 

Not quite a Baggins type ring, but it occasionally seems to have a mind of its own.
